What is Betamethasone Cream?
Betamethasone Cream is a topical corticosteroid medication produced by GlaxoSmithKline Pharmaceuticals Ltd, designed to relieve inflammation and itching caused by various allergic skin conditions. It contains the active ingredient Betamethasone, a potent anti-inflammatory agent used extensively in dermatology to manage allergy symptoms such as eczema, dermatitis, and other inflammatory skin disorders.
Uses of Betamethasone Cream
This cream is primarily used to treat allergy symptoms including redness, swelling, itching, and irritation on the skin. It is effective for several conditions such as:
- Atopic dermatitis (eczema)
- Contact dermatitis triggered by allergens
- Psoriasis
- Insect bites causing allergic reactions
- Other inflammatory skin conditions that respond to corticosteroids
Betamethasone Cream helps reduce discomfort and promotes healing by controlling the body's allergic response on the skin.
How Betamethasone Cream Works
Betamethasone acts by suppressing the immune system’s inflammatory response. When applied to the skin, it reduces the production of substances that cause inflammation, redness, and swelling. This helps soothe allergy symptoms, providing relief from itching and discomfort. The cream penetrates the skin layers to modulate the allergic reaction locally without affecting the whole body when used as directed.

Dosage and Administration
Apply a thin layer of Betamethasone Cream to the affected skin gently 1 to 2 times daily or as directed by your healthcare professional. It is important not to use more than the recommended amount or for longer than prescribed to avoid potential side effects. Wash your hands before and after applying the cream, and avoid contact with eyes, mouth, or other mucous membranes.

Who Should Avoid Betamethasone Cream?
Avoid using Betamethasone Cream if you have known hypersensitivity or allergy to betamethasone or any component of the cream. It should not be used on infected skin without appropriate antimicrobial therapy. Pregnant or breastfeeding women should consult their doctor before use. Additionally, individuals with certain skin conditions or systemic infections should seek medical advice before using topical steroids.
Possible Side Effects
While generally safe when used as directed, some users may experience side effects such as:
- Skin irritation or burning sensation
- Dryness or peeling of the skin
- Thinning of the skin with prolonged use
- Stretch marks or increased hair growth in the treated area
- Allergic reactions, including rash or swelling
If you notice severe irritation or signs of infection, discontinue use and consult your healthcare provider immediately.
Safety Advice
Use Betamethasone Cream strictly as prescribed. Do not apply on large areas or under occlusive dressings unless directed by a doctor. Avoid exposure to sunlight on treated areas as steroids can increase photosensitivity. Store out of reach of children and do not share with others. Inform your healthcare provider of any other medications you are using to prevent interactions.
Drug Interactions
Betamethasone Cream has minimal systemic absorption; however, combining it with other topical medications, such as other corticosteroids or immunosuppressants, may increase side effects. Inform your doctor if you are using antifungal, antiviral, or antibacterial creams alongside this product. Systemic medications that affect immune function should be discussed with your healthcare provider to avoid adverse reactions.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
How long does it take Betamethasone Cream to work?
Most users experience relief of itching and redness within a few days of consistent application. However, full improvement may take 1 to 2 weeks depending on the severity of the condition.
What should I do if Betamethasone Cream does not work?
If you see no improvement after 2 weeks or if symptoms worsen, stop using the cream and consult your healthcare provider for further evaluation or alternative treatments.
Can I use Betamethasone Cream with other medicines?
Inform your doctor about all medications you take, including other topical creams or oral drugs. Avoid combining multiple corticosteroids unless specifically advised to prevent increased side effects.
Is Betamethasone Cream safe for older adults?
Yes, it can be safely used by older adults under medical supervision. Older skin may be more sensitive, so careful monitoring is recommended to avoid thinning or irritation.
What happens if I miss a dose?
If you forget to apply the cream, use it as soon as you remember. Do not double the dose to compensate for the missed application.
Can side effects of Betamethasone Cream be prevented?
Following the prescribed dosage, avoiding prolonged use, and applying only to affected areas help minimize side effects. Report any irritation promptly to your healthcare provider.
Is Betamethasone Cream safe for daily use?
Short-term daily use is generally safe when prescribed. Long-term or excessive application may increase risks and should be avoided unless specifically recommended by a doctor.
